Abstract
The working site providing reactive oxygen was examined from the angular an d velocity distributions of the desorbing product, CO2, on Pd(100), Pd(110) , and Pt(113) by means of cross-correlation time-of-flight techniques. Arou nd a critical CO pressure where the rate-determining step of CO oxidation s hifted from CO adsorption to O-2 dissociation, site switching was confirmed for CO2 formation on Pt(113) and Pd(110). On the other hand, no site switc hing was found on Pd(100) although clear changes were observed in the chemi cal kinetics for CO2 formation.
